WA52 YVT is a 2002 Jaguar S-type in Silver with a 2,967cc petrol engine. This vehicle has been through 23 MOT tests with a personal pass rate of 65.2%.
Across all 2002 Jaguar S-type models, the average MOT pass rate is 73.9% with a typical mileage of 76,503 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Jaguar S-type f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 43,168 recorded failures. If you're considering buying WA52 YVT, it's worth having these areas checked by a mechanic before committing.
The Jaguar S-type typically stays on UK roads for around 27 years. At 24 years old, this Jaguar S-type is approaching the upper end of the typical lifespan for this model.
